What is the West Virginia Retiree Health and Life Insurance Enrollment Form?
The West Virginia Retiree Health and Life Insurance Enrollment Form is essential for retirees in West Virginia who wish to enroll in health and basic life insurance coverage. This document requires specific personal information, Medicare details, and coverage selections from the retiree. Key components include sections dedicated to the retiree's demographics, beneficiaries, and desired health and life coverage options. Completing this form is a crucial step in the overall retirement benefits process, ensuring retirees have access to necessary medical and financial support.

Who Needs the West Virginia Retiree Health and Life Insurance Enrollment Form?
This form is designed for specific individuals, ensuring that they receive appropriate health and life insurance coverage. Eligible participants include retired state employees and their beneficiaries. The role of the agency benefit coordinator is important, as they provide guidance on filling out the form accurately and ensure all necessary documentation is in order. Who is eligible to fill out the West Virginia Retiree Health and Life Insurance Enrollment Form?
Eligibility to fill out the form generally includes any retiree in West Virginia who wishes to enroll in health and life insurance coverage, along with their Agency Benefit Coordinators.
What is the deadline for submitting the health and life insurance enrollment form?
While specific deadlines may not be mentioned in the metadata, it is advisable to submit the form as soon as possible to ensure timely enrollment in insurance coverage.
How can I submit the completed enrollment form?
You can submit the completed West Virginia Retiree Health and Life Insurance Enrollment Form electronically through pdfFiller or print it out for mail-in submission, as per your preference.
What supporting documents are required with the form?
You may need to provide supporting documents such as identification, Medicare information, and proof of dependency status where applicable. Check your local agency's requirements for specifics.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the form?
Common mistakes include leaving required fields blank, incorrect Medicare details, and failing to obtain necessary signatures from the retiree and agency benefit coordinator.
How long does it take to process the West Virginia retiree insurance enrollment form?
Processing times can vary, but typically allow several weeks for the enrollment to be processed once submitted. It’s best to check with your agency for specific timelines.
Is notarization required for this enrollment form?
No, notarization is not required for the West Virginia Retiree Health and Life Insurance Enrollment Form, making it easier for retirees to complete and submit.
